How they compare
Central African Republic currently reports 64,438 against 57,874 in Cuba, a difference of 6,564.
That makes Central African Republic's figure about 1.1 times Cuba's.
The two have swapped places 1 time across 25 shared years of data; in 1990 it was Cuba ahead.
Central African Republic ranks 97th and Cuba ranks 99th of 191 countries.
Across the 3 decades both report, Central African Republic averaged higher in 1 and Cuba in 2.
